Feature comparison

Compare ReplyRadar with Syften on the workflow that matters.

CategoryReplyRadarSyften
Primary jobFind recommendation requests, complaint-heavy threads, and public buying-intent conversations worth a manual reply.Alert-first monitoring across a wide range of online communities.
Best forFounders and lean GTM teams that want a smaller queue with clearer reasons why each thread matters.Founders or marketers who want wide community alerts and are comfortable doing more of the downstream qualification themselves.
Signal emphasisRecommendation language, alternatives, competitor complaints, urgency, and audience fit.Strong for broad community keyword alerts and lower-noise monitoring compared with very simple alerts.
Coverage modelSelective public-conversation discovery oriented around action and manual participation.Strong community coverage with less focus on in-workflow reply qualification than ReplyRadar.
Team fitBest when a founder or small team wants to keep the workflow operator-friendly and low-noise.Good for teams that want alert breadth across communities without a heavy enterprise stack.
Why buyers switchReplyRadar is more explicit about fit, urgency, and reply-worthiness once the signal appears.Teams that want a more opinionated workflow around which public conversations deserve manual action.
